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Arend’s Golden Mole | Baker's Wattle |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om | Animalia (動物) | Plantae (植物) |
| Phylum | Chordata (脊索動物) | Magnoliophyta (被子植物門) |
| Class | Mammalia (哺乳類) | Magnoliopsida (モクレン綱) |
| Order | Afrosoricida (アフリカトガリネズミ目) | Fabales (マメ目) |
| Family | Chrysochloridae | Fabaceae |
| Genus | Carpitalpa | Acacia |
| Species | Carpitalpa arendsi | Acacia bakeri |
